“Dear PoPville,
I saw this sign at the LeDroit Park dog park. Almost every evening, unsupervised children come to the dog park to play with the dogs. Generally speaking, the kids are curious and friendly and positive experiences are had. However, I’ve always been worried that a kid might inadvertently get hurt. I was not present with this incident occurred, but the fact that this parent is now looking for the dog owner leads me to believe they were not present when this bite happened, otherwise I’m sure that information would have been exchanged. Some dogs simply don’t like kids, or when dogs are running around someone could get knocked down and hurt. Does the city have rules on this? I fear some good dogs could get put down because children are entering dog parks unsupervised.”
